Какой рейтинг вас больше интересует?
|
Главная / Главные темы / Тэг «browserify»
Обновление React компонентов с сохранением состояния в режиме реального времени для Browserify 2015-08-05 12:04:45
+ развернуть текст сохранённая копия
Всем доброго времени суток!
Давайте немного поговорим о DX (Developer Experience) или «Опыте разработки», а если конкретнее — об обновлении кода в режиме реального времени с сохранением состояния системы. Если тема для вас в новинку, то перед прочтением советую ознакомиться со следующими видео:
Ряд видео с обновлением кода в реальном времени без перезагрузки страницы
Введение: Как это работает?
Прежде всего стоит понимать, что реализация подобной функциональности подразумевает под собой решение ряда задач:
— Отслеживание изменений файлов
— Вычисление патча на основании изменений файлов
— Транспортировка патча на клиент (в браузер, например)
— Обработка и применение патча к существующему коду
Но обо всём по порядку.
Читать дальше →
Тэги: browserify, hmr, javascript, live, patch, react, reactjs, веб-разработка, программирование
Ещё один пост о сборке front-end проекта 2015-03-02 15:36:38
+ развернуть текст сохранённая копия
Я потратил прилично времени на структуризацию и автоматизацию сборки фронта. Задача это интересная и стоит того, чтобы о ней рассказать.
Что умеет делать сборщик:
- Собирать front-end проект для development & production окружений.
- Собирать по несколько js/css бандлов на проект.
- Использовать стиль CommonJS модулей в браузере.
- Использовать ES6-синтаксис.
- Спрайты, картинки и многое другое.
Читать дальше →
Тэги: babel, browserify, css, es6, gulp, html, jade, javascript, stylus, веб-разработка
[Из песочницы] Продвинутый Gulp и Browserify: интересные трюки 2014-11-05 14:32:34
... вы не любите browserify.
Краткое ... собственных плагинов для Browserify;
создание ...
+ развернуть текст сохранённая копия
Пару недель назад я начал цикл о том, как делал некоммерческий музыкальный проект (первый пост есть в «я пиарюсь», не буду ставить ссылок), но, к сожалению, в первой же статье увлекся, и вместо того, чтобы рассказывать о том, как делал конкретно его, начал вспоминать эффективные трюки из других проектов. Видимо, именно это вкупе с прописанным акцентом на сам проект привело к тому, что за мной и постом прилетело НЛО.
Однако все то, что было в статье, было по крайней мере малоизвестно, а половина ее была вообще уникальна, как я уверен, и каждый из этих советов может ощутимо облегчить работу с gulp, поэтому мне действительно было бы жаль, если этот материал безвозвратно пропал бы.
Поэтому я постарался убрать все упоминания проекта и повторно публикую (с доработками и правками) статью, которую по сути никто еще не видел. Если вы фанат grunt — почитайте хотя бы вторую часть: то, что вы не любите gulp, не значит, что вы не любите browserify.
Краткое содержание:
- Простой способ обработки ошибок;
- Универсальная структура для хранения исходных файлов;
- Объединение нескольких потоков (например, скомпилированный coffee и js) в один;
- Создание потока из текста;
- создание собственных плагинов для Browserify;
- создание плагинов из плагинов Gulp для Browserify.
Читать дальше →
Тэги: browserify, gulp, html, javascript, веб-разработка, плагины
[Перевод] Построение надежных веб-приложений на React: Часть 2, оптимизация с Browserify 2014-07-15 12:11:36
... 2, optimising with Browserify», Matt Hinchliffe
+ развернуть текст сохранённая копия
Перевод статьи «Building robust web apps with React: Part 2, optimising with Browserify», Matt Hinchliffe
От переводчика: это перевод второй части цикла статей «Building robust web apps with React», вот ссылка на перевод первой части. Перевод следующей части появится через несколько дней.
В первой части, я осветил причины, почему по моему мнению, React захватывающий инструмент, который может быть использован для построения изоморфный или адаптивно-гибридных веб-сайтов, что может равняться динамичности мобильных приложений и надежности статичной страницы двадцатилетней давности. Я также написал базовое демо приложение, чтобы исследовать некоторые парадигмы и особенности React и показать, как быстро можно прототипировать динамические браузерные приложения, но это едва ли демонстрирует надежность, к которой я изначально стремился.
Код, который в начальном демо был представлен на выполнение браузеру, не проходит ни один базовый тест производительности; скрипты должны быть прекомпилированы, объединены и минифицированы перед отправкой на продакшн. Читать дальше →
Тэги: browserify, javascript, react, react.js, web-разработка, веб-разработка
Главная / Главные темы / Тэг «browserify»
|
Взлеты Топ 5
Падения Топ 5
|